Green kitchen cabinets have been gaining popularity in recent years as more homeowners seek out environmentally-friendly and stylish options for their homes. Green cabinets can add a pop of color and personality to your kitchen while also helping to reduce your carbon footprint.

One of the biggest advantages of green kitchen cabinets is their eco-friendly construction. Many green cabinets are made from sustainable materials such as bamboo, reclaimed wood, or FSC-certified wood. These materials are renewable and have a lower impact on the environment compared to traditional cabinetry materials like particleboard or MDF. By choosing green cabinets, you can feel good about reducing your impact on the planet.
